Foundation Crack Sealing in Sarasota, FL
Foundation crack sealing involves applying specialized materials to close and reinforce cracks in a property's foundation.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including small surface cracks, larger structural fissures, and areas where water infiltration may be a concern. Homeowners typically seek foundation crack sealing to prevent further damage, maintain structural integrity, and improve the overall stability of the building. Before requesting this service, property owners should assess the size, location, and pattern of the cracks, and consider whether they have experienced signs of shifting or water intrusion around the foundation.
Understanding the extent of foundation cracking is essential for determining the appropriate sealing method. It’s common for property owners to inquire about the types of cracks that can be repaired, the materials used for sealing, and how the process can help prevent future issues. Proper sealing can help protect the foundation from moisture damage and reduce the risk of more extensive repairs down the line. Foundation Crack Sealing Questions
What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, settling, or temperature changes affecting the structure.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ious issues? Not necessarily; small, hairline cracks are common and often harmless, but larger or expanding cracks may need evaluation.
How does sealing foundation cracks help? Sealing prevents water intrusion, which can cause further damage and help maintain the stability of the foundation.
When is the best time to address foundation cracks? It’s advisable to evaluate and repair cracks as soon as they are noticed to prevent potential structural problems.
